Stone siding repair services focus on restoring and maintaining the integrity of stone exteriors on residential and commercial properties. These services typically involve assessing the condition of existing stonework, removing damaged or deteriorated stones, and replacing or re-mortaring them to ensure stability and appearance. Skilled contractors may also perform cleaning and sealing to protect the stone from further damage caused by weathering, moisture infiltration, or biological growth. Proper repair helps preserve the aesthetic appeal of the property while preventing structural issues that can arise from compromised stonework.

The primary problems addressed by stone siding repair include cracking, crumbling, staining, and loose or missing stones. Over time, exposure to elements such as rain, snow, and temperature fluctuations can cause mortar joints to weaken and stones to shift or break. These issues not only impact the visual appeal but can also lead to water infiltration, which may cause interior damage or mold growth. Repair services aim to stabilize the stone facade, prevent further deterioration, and restore the original look of the siding, thereby extending the lifespan of the exterior.

Material and Scope Costs - The cost for stone siding repair typically ranges from $1,200 to $4,500 depending on the extent of damage and the type of stone. Minor repairs, such as replacing individual stones, tend to be on the lower end, while extensive restoration can increase costs.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on specific project needs.

Labor Expenses - Labor costs for stone siding repair usually fall between $50 and $100 per hour. The total labor fee depends on the size of the area and complexity of the work involved. Larger or more intricate repairs may require additional labor hours, impacting overall costs.

Additional Materials - Costs for replacement stones, mortar, and other materials can add $200 to $1,000 or more to the project. The price varies based on stone type, quality, and quantity needed for the repair. Local service providers can help determine the exact material costs for each project.

Project Size and Complexity - Smaller repairs, such as patching or replacing a few stones, may cost around $500 to $1,500. Larger or more complex repairs, involving extensive sections or structural work, can range from $3,000 to over $10,000. Costs are influenced by the scope and difficulty of the repair work.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What causes stone siding to need repair? Damage from weather, settling of the building, or impact from debris can lead to cracks or looseness in stone siding requiring repair.

How can I tell if my stone siding needs repairs? Visible cracks, loose stones, or water intrusion are common signs indicating that repair services may be needed.

What types of stone siding repairs are available? Repairs may include replacing damaged stones, re-mortaring joints, or restoring the overall appearance of the siding.

Are stone siding repairs a DIY project? Due to the complexity and need for specialized skills, it is recommended to hire experienced local pros for stone siding repairs.

How long do stone siding repairs typically take? The duration depends on the extent of damage, but a professional assessment can provide an estimated timeframe for the repair process.
